In this study, a high power-density dual-output piezoelectric transformer is proposed and experimentally investigated. This transformer consists of a lead zirconate titanate (PZT) ceramic plate with a size of 30 turn x 5 mm x 1 turn. It has a high mechanical quality factor Q(m) and high electromechanical coupling coefficient k(eff). The PZT ceramic plate is poled along the width direction. The electrodes of input and output parts are on the top and bottom surfaces of the ceramic plate and separated by narrow gaps. Lead wires are pressed on the electrodes by a proper elastic force. At a temperature rise lower than 20degreesC, the piezoelectric transformer has a maximum output power density of 52.7 W/cm(3) with an efficiency of 88%. The maximum efficiency of this piezoelectric transformer is 95%. Voltage gains larger than one and smaller than one are obtained in one transformer. By using a parallel combination of the two outputs of the proposed transformer, a higher output power density of 57.3 W/cm(3) can be achieved at the temperature rise lower than 20degreesC.
